    Do you drink alcohol? Why would smoking pot be different? And before you answer that, read my response to the previous comment. Opposition to marijuana seems to be ingrained in some people, many of them older. Whereas my parents would have never partaken, their sons and grandchildren do. It's generational. For the record, I'm 64. Last May I was at a party celebrating a law school graduation. Sometime after midnight, there were a handful of 20somethings (a few graduates, their significant others, and their parents) sitting in the backyard after lots of alcohol consumption. At that point, anyone walking by the cluster of people on Adirondack chairs could have gotten high from the smoke cloud. Attitudes evolve and if we ignore changes we can become obsolete ourselves. A long time ago, the couple with season hockey tickets behind mine, admitted they encouraged their 16yo daughter to smoke pot at home. The mother claimed kids would do it anyway and she felt safer if her kid was at home when doing it.
